Walden C. Rhines
CEO & Chairman, Mentor Graphics
Dr. Rhines, a leader in worldwide electronic design automation. Prior to joining Mentor Graphics, Rhines was Executive Vice President of Texas Instruments’ Semiconductor Group, sharing responsibility for TI’s Components Sector, and having direct responsibility for the entire semiconductor business with more than $5 billion of revenue and over 30,000 people. Rhines is currently in his fourth term as Chairman of the Electronic Design Automation Consortium. He is also a board member of the Semiconductor Research Corporation, Lewis and Clark College and the Portland Classic Wines Auction. He has previously served as chairman of the Semiconductor Technical Advisory Committee of the Department of Commerce, as an executive committee member of the board of directors of the Corporation for Open Systems and as a board member of the Computer and Business Equipment Manufacturers Association (CBEMA), SEMI-Sematech/SISA, Electronic Design Automation Consortium (EDAC), University of Michigan National Advisory Council and Sematech.

Dr. Naveen Gautam
Managing Director, Hella India Automotive
Dr. Gautam is an expert in automotive electronics and systems development. Dr. Gautam also has extensive experience on vehicle E/E architecture design, common features and components deployment across carlines. He has over 25 years of experience in academia and industry worldwide. Prior to taking over current role, he was responsible for establishing Hella electronics development center in Pune which was founded to cater R&D needs of Hella for developing local products for Indian automotive customers and supporting global development projects from India.
Dr. Gautam is a Mechanical Engineering graduate with Manufacturing Science M.Tech from IIT Kanpur. He also acquired his Ph.D. in lean product development from Wayne State University Detroit, USA.
